Output 889017d5a73104d3167caadbe0c778a3cd0d3eb66cc874b335e757516c5aa44f:1

value
493393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 020de3a0ab2fa4d86940bdb3390df45ae6a15764 OP_EQUAL
address
31ssuxrn4R2VcHkyFY9fp1C3mAq3seefFc
transaction
889017d5a73104d3167caadbe0c778a3cd0d3eb66cc874b335e757516c5aa44f
spent
true